One solid sphere A and another hollow spher B are of same mass and same outer radii. Their moment of inertia aobut their diameters are respectively `I_A and I_B` such that
where `d_A and d_B` are their densities,
A. `I_A lt I_B`
B. `I_A gt I_B`
C. `I_A = I_B`
D. `(I_A)/(I_B) = (d_A)/(d_B)`

Correct Answer - A
(a) The moment of inertia of solid spere A about its diameter
`I_A = (2)/(5)MR^2`
The moment of inertia of a hollow sphere B about its
diameter `I_B = (2)/(3)MR^2. :. I_AltI_B`
